The role

You’ll play a key part in driving growth by identifying and engaging new prospects, building relationships, and creating opportunities for the wider sales team.


That will include:

  • Reaching out to potential customers through calls, emails, and LinkedIn
  • Building a pipeline of qualified opportunities
  • Researching target accounts and understanding their needs
  • Booking meetings for the senior sales team
  • Working closely with internal teams to refine messaging and approach


This is a role where resilience and consistency matter. The best BDRs here are proactive, comfortable with rejection, and motivated to keep improving.
